peanut butter chocolate hazelnut and chocolate chip beef jerky cookies

This cookie is definitely worth a try! Creamy peanut butter and chocolaty hazelnut spread and highlighted by the smoky and salty flavors of beef jerky.

Ingredients

  • 3/4 cup butter, softened (1 1/2 sticks)
  • 1/2 cup sugar
  • 1/3 cup brown sugar
  • 1/2 cup creamy peanut butter
  • 1/2 cup chocolate-hazelnut spread
  • 1 egg
  • 1 tablespoon vanilla extract
  • 1 1/2 cups all purpose flour
  • 1 teaspoon baking soda
  • 1/4 teaspoon kosher salt
  • 2/3 cup finely chopped beef jerky
  • 1/4 cup bittersweet chocolate chips

Directions

  1. Preheat oven to 350°F. Combine butter, sugars, peanut butter and hazelnut-chocolate spread in large bowl. Using hand or stand mixer, mix until and fluffy. Add egg and vanilla; mix until fully incorporated.
  2. Combine flour, baking soda and salt in medium bowl; whisk together. Add flour mixture to butter mixture; mix until fully incorporated; do not over mix. Add in jerky and chocolate chips. Divide dough into 24 equal balls. Place on 2 ungreased shallow-rimmed baking sheets. Bake in 350°F oven 13 to 15 minutes or until tops are evenly cracked. Cool 10 minutes before serving.

NUTRITIONAL INFORMATION
Nutrition information per serving: 208 Calories; 11.3g Total Fat; 6.2g Saturated Fat; 1g Polyunsaturated Fat; 3.3g Monounsaturated Fat; 0.2g Trans Fat; 29mg Cholesterol; 251mg Sodium; 80mg Potassium; 22g Total carbohydrate; 5g Protein; 1.1mg Iron; 1.2mg Niacin; 0mg Vitamin B6; 12.4mg Choline; 0.1mcg Vitamin B12; 0.3mg Zinc; 4mcg Selenium; 0.6g Fiber.
